** The Dodge repair market serving Hemingway, SC, is characteristic of a rural region. There are no dedicated Dodge/SRT specialists operating directly within Hemingway. The local market consists of a few general auto repair shops capable of handling basic maintenance but lacking the specialized tools, software, and expertise for complex high-performance diagnostics, tuning, and transmission work. Therefore, residents of Hemingway seeking expert service for their HEMI, SRT, or Hellcat vehicles must look to surrounding population centers like Kingstree, Florence, and Conway. The competition for this high-end work is moderate, with a clear distinction between general repair shops and true performance specialists. **Mr. Tire & Auto** in Florence represents the top-tier for OEM-level diagnosis and repair, while **T&T Performance** in Conway is the undisputed leader for aftermarket performance and tuning. **A1 Foreign & Domestic** fills the crucial role of a reliable, local-ish shop for foundational engine and mechanical work. Pricing reflects this specialization. General labor rates in the area range from $90-$120/hour, while performance shops like T&T command rates of $125-$175/hour for their expert tuning and fabrication services. Parts markup is standard, but performance parts are naturally more expensive. Owners should expect to invest significantly in proper maintenance and repairs for these complex, high-horsepower vehicles.

Given our rural roads and hot, humid climate, we frequently address suspension components worn by uneven surfaces and cooling system issues, including radiator and thermostat failures on Dodge trucks and SUVs. Electrical gremlins, particularly in older Dodge Rams and Dakotas, are also common due to moisture and heat.
Look for a local shop with certified technicians who have specific training with Dodge/Chrysler vehicles, such as those with Mopar certification. In Hemingway and nearby areas like Conway or Florence, check for strong community reputation, verified customer reviews, and whether they use quality, name-brand parts for repairs.
Labor rates in Hemingway are often more competitive than in major metropolitan areas, which can lower overall costs. However, for specialized parts not kept in local inventory, there may be a slight delay and associated shipping fees, though a good shop will communicate this upfront.
Seek immediate service if you notice persistent rough idling, loss of power while towing or hauling, or the check engine light flashing. These can indicate serious issues like misfires that could lead to costly catalytic converter damage, especially important for the stop-and-go driving common on local properties.
